After the Storm, Who Helps Rebuild the Horizon?

France has supported expanded international funding efforts aimed at helping Ukraine recover damaged infrastructure, restore public services, and strengthen humanitarian assistance programs for affected communities.

After the Storm, Who Helps Rebuild the Horizon?

When conflict captures global attention, the focus often settles on events unfolding in the present moment. Yet beyond every headline lies another story—one concerned not with destruction, but with recovery. Roads must be repaired, schools reopened, hospitals restored, and communities supported as they attempt to rebuild daily life. It is within this broader context that France has expressed support for expanded international funding dedicated to Ukraine’s recovery and humanitarian programs.

The effort reflects a growing recognition that reconstruction requires long-term commitment. While emergency assistance remains vital, recovery programs increasingly focus on helping communities regain stability and restore essential services. Infrastructure, healthcare, education, and local economic activity all play important roles in this process.

France has joined other international partners in supporting initiatives designed to strengthen recovery efforts. Such programs typically involve cooperation between governments, international financial institutions, humanitarian organizations, and development agencies. The objective is to ensure that assistance addresses both immediate needs and longer-term challenges.

Across Ukraine, rebuilding efforts continue in areas affected by years of disruption. Communities face varying degrees of damage, with some requiring extensive reconstruction while others focus on restoring public services and economic activity. Recovery programs seek to provide resources that can support these diverse needs.

Funding commitments often extend beyond physical infrastructure. Humanitarian assistance remains an important component of recovery strategies, particularly for vulnerable populations affected by displacement, economic hardship, or limited access to services. Support programs frequently include healthcare initiatives, housing assistance, and community development projects.

France has emphasized the importance of international cooperation throughout the recovery process. Large-scale reconstruction efforts require expertise, financing, and coordination across multiple sectors. Collaborative approaches help maximize resources while supporting efficient implementation of projects.

Observers note that recovery is rarely a linear process. Economic conditions, security considerations, and logistical challenges can influence progress. Nevertheless, sustained international engagement can help create conditions that encourage stability and long-term development.

Investment in recovery also carries broader significance. Rebuilding infrastructure and public services contributes to economic resilience, supports employment opportunities, and strengthens local communities. Such efforts can help lay foundations for future growth while addressing the immediate consequences of conflict.

International institutions continue to play a central role in coordinating support and identifying priorities. By aligning funding with specific needs, organizations seek to ensure that assistance delivers meaningful and measurable outcomes for affected populations.

As France supports expanded recovery funding, the initiative highlights an important reality: the end goal of humanitarian assistance is not merely survival, but the restoration of opportunity and normalcy. Recovery may unfold gradually, but each project, service, and investment contributes to a larger effort aimed at helping communities move forward.
